Handle the ContextDisposing event, and set the Cancel() property of the EntityDataSourceContextDisposingEventArgs to true. This prevents the disposal of the ObjectContext. For more information, see Object Context Life-Cycle Management (EntityDataSource).
This example maintains the ObjectContext for future reference by handling the ContextCreated event.
protected void EntityDataSource2_ContextDisposing(object sender,
EntityDataSourceContextDisposingEventArgs e)
{
e.Cancel = true;
}
